U.S. looking to broaden access to COVID-19 antiviral pills - WSJThe administration is reviewing whether Paxlovid, the antiviral from Pfizer Inc, can be available on the commercial market in retail pharmacies if it gets regulatory clearance, the Journal reported. Molnupiravir, an oral pill from Merck & Co Inc and Ridgeback Biotherapeutics LP that is also under regulatory review, may be included in the government's plan to make it commercially available, the journal reported, citing the person. The United States has agreed to buy 10 million courses of Pfizer's drug and has so far secured 3.1 million courses of Merck's pill.
